Subject:

Combined Inspection 50-352/78-10; 50-353/78-06

,

This refers to the inspection conducted by Mr. J. Mattia of this office

=

on November 27 - December 1 and December 6,1978, at Limerick Generating

Station, Units 1 and 2, of activities authorized by NRC License Nos.

"

.

CPPR-106 and CPPR-107, and to the uiscussions of our findings held by

-- -

Mr. Mattia with Mr. Corcoran and others of your staff at the conclusion

-

of the inspection.

Areas examined during this inspection are described in the Office of

Inspection and Enforcement Inspection Report which is enclosed with this

letter. Within these areas, the inspection consisted of selective

'

'

examinations of procedures and representative records, interviews with

,

personnel, measurements made by the inspector, and observations by the

inspector.

.

Within the scope of this inspection, no items of noncompliance were

observed.
